Hotpoint TC71 blowing cold?

I've checked the continuity of all 3 of the cut out switches and the heating element and they are ok, but still no heat.
Does anyone have any other ideas or a wiring diagram?

I've just had similar problems with an old TC71. I changed the thermostats (yes both) and heating element and still couldn't get the machine to heat.

Then I followed the wires from the thermostat back, some run under the (condenser) fan housing to an impossibly hidden little float chamber switch (it must cut off the heating elements once the water tank is full). In my machine the float movement was "lint-stuck" and once freed I had a fully functioning dryer again.

The machine is now near 15-years old and will hopefully last for many years to come! Maybe this tip might help somebody?
